Shekhawati Haveli, JhunjhunuJhunjhunu is a district in the state of Rajasthan that lies about 180 kilometres off Jaipur. The district was constructed in the memory of the Jujhar Singh Nehra of the Nehra clan. Jhunjhunu is the largest of all the towns in Shekhawati and is known for its splendid forts and havelis. Havelis namely Muragh Das Modi and Khaitans are worth a visit.

There are several other attractions in Jhunjhunu. Shri Ranisatiji Mandir in Jhunjhunu is an ancient pilgrimage in India. The temple is a historic masterpiece. The Khetri Mahal built in 1760 is another place of tourist interest that is quite sophisticated in its architecture. The Modi and Tiberwala Havelis that stand in the main market of Jhunjhunu are interesting structures. The chhatris and wells can be seen in large numbers around Jhunjhunu town. In addition to these, places namely Qamruddin Shah ki Dargah, Laxminath Temple, Badal Garh, Mertani Baori, Birdhi Chand Well, Ishwardas Mohandas Haveli and Ajeet Sagar are also worth visiting.
